Arctic Sunwest Charters operates as a charter airline, so check-in procedures differ from scheduled carriers. Contact the airline directly at +1 867 873 4464 or [email protected] to confirm check-in timing and location for your specific flight. Check-in is typically arranged with the charter booking and may occur at a dedicated charter terminal or the airline's operations facility rather than a public airport counter.
General check-in steps:
- Arrive at the designated check-in location at the time specified by the airline (typically 1–2 hours before departure for remote flights)
- Present your passport or government-issued ID and booking confirmation
- Declare any special baggage or equipment
- Proceed through security screening as required for your departure airport
Practical tip: Remote Arctic flights are weather-dependent. Arrive prepared for possible delays or rescheduling, and maintain contact with the airline the day before departure.
What documentation do I need for Arctic flights?
A valid government-issued photo ID and passport are required. If traveling to remote communities, confirm any local entry requirements with the airline, as some destinations may have additional regulations.
Can I change my charter booking once confirmed?
Changes depend on the charter contract terms. Contact the airline immediately to discuss modifications. Availability and penalties vary, so discuss your situation directly with their booking team.
